The Voiceless Chalet, released in 2022, is a curious drama that draws you in with its eerie, almost claustrophobic atmosphere. The film is set against the backdrop of a remote chalet, and it really nails that sense of isolation and introspection. The pacing is deliberate, allowing tension to build gradually, which keeps you engaged throughout. While the director remains unknown, the performances are quite compelling, with a raw authenticity that feels both unsettling and real. The themes of silence and communication—or lack thereof—are explored in a way that’s thought-provoking. Practical effects are minimal but effective, adding to the film's haunting quality, and the overall tone lingers long after the credits roll. It's definitely a distinctive piece that might resonate more with those who appreciate subtle storytelling.
